        ## About The Light Side
        
        **Light Side** is an low-light image enhancement library  that consist state-of-the-art deep learning methods. The light side of the Force is referenced. The aim is to create a light structure that will find the `Light Side of the Night`.

        > **Low-light image enhancement** aims at improving the perception or interpretability of an image captured in an environment with poor illumination.

        <!-- USAGE EXAMPLES -->
        ## Usage Examples
        
        ```python
        import imageio
        import light_side as ls
        
        img = imageio.imread("test.jpg")
        
        model = ls.Enhancer.from_pretrained("model_config_dataset")
        model.eval()
        
        results = model.predict(img)
        ```

        <!-- TESTS -->
        ## Tests
        
        During development, you might like to have tests run.
        
        Install dependencies
        
        ```bash
        pip install -e ".[test]"
        ```
        
        ### Linting Tests
        
        ```bash
        pytest light_side --pylint --pylint-error-types=EF
        ```
        
        ### Document Tests
        
        ```bash
        pytest light_side --doctest-modules
        ```
        
        ### Coverage Tests
        
        ```bash
        pytest --doctest-modules --cov light_side --cov-report term
        ```
